使用SWINGX的Highlighter对表格设置背景色和前景色
注:最近开始学习swing编程,使用到了swingx,但是网上相关资料比较少,然后做了一些例子。
本例主要是对表格中的单元格动态设置背景色,
但是完成后发现再根据列排序时,相应的单元格背景色没有随之移动,希望牛人给些建议!
首先奉上截图效果:

那么,通过右键可以设置表格背景色。
例子源码结构:
- AuditTableColumnsHighlighter
- AuditTableCellsHighlighter
- AuditTableRowsHighlighter
这三个主要负责改变背景色或者前景色。
- DefaultJXTable
这个继承自JXTable,并添加了右键菜单选项响应事件。
- TestFrame
测试类。
一下是部分代码:
AuditTableCellsHighlighter.class
public class AuditTableCellsHighlighter extends AbstractHighlighter {
private int [] rows;
private int [] columns;
private boolean bg_fg = true;
private Color selectedColor;
private JXTable table;
public AuditTableCellsHighlighter(JXTable table, Color selectedColor){
this.rows = table.getSelectedRows();
this.columns = table.getSelectedColumns();
this.selectedColor = selectedColor;
this.table = table;
}
public AuditTableCellsHighlighter(JXTable table, Color selectedColor, boolean bg_fg){
this.rows = table.getSelectedRows();
this.columns = table.getSelectedColumns();
this.bg_fg = bg_fg;
this.selectedColor = selectedColor;
this.table = table;
}
@Override
protected boolean canHighlight(Component component, ComponentAdapter adapter) {
if(adapter.getComponent() instanceof DefaultJXTable ){
return true;
}else{
return false;
}
}
@Override
protected Component doHighlight(Component renderer, ComponentAdapter adapter) {
if(inArray(rows, adapter.row) && inArray(columns, adapter.column)){
boolean b = bg_fg == true ? applyBackground(renderer, adapter) : applyForeground(renderer, adapter);
}
return renderer;
}
protected boolean applyBackground(Component renderer, ComponentAdapter adapter) {
if (selectedColor != null) {
renderer.setBackground(selectedColor);
}
return true;
}
protected boolean applyForeground(Component renderer, ComponentAdapter adapter) {
if (selectedColor != null) {
renderer.setForeground(selectedColor);
}
return true;
}
protected boolean inArray(int [] array, int value){
for (int i : array) {
if(i == value)
return true;
}
return false;
}
}
public class DefaultJXTable extends JXTable{
private JPopupMenu tablePopupMenu;
private boolean CELLS_BG = true;
private boolean CELLS_FG = false;
private boolean ROWS_BG = true;
private boolean ROWS_FG = false;
private boolean COLUMNS_BG = true;
private boolean COLUMNS_FG = false;
public DefaultJXTable() {
super();
createPopuMenu();
}
protected void addColumnModelAdapter(){
getColumnModel().addColumnModelListener(new TableColumnModelAdapter(this));
}
protected void createPopuMenu(){
tablePopupMenu = new JPopupMenu();
JMenuItem cellsbgHithlighter = new JMenuItem("设置单元格背景色");
cellsbgHithlighter.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
addHighlighter(new AuditTableCellsHighlighter(DefaultJXTable.this, ColorUtil.showColorChooser(DefaultJXTable.this), CELLS_BG));
}
});
tablePopupMenu.add(cellsbgHithlighter);
JMenuItem cellsfgHithlighter = new JMenuItem("设置单元格前景色");
cellsfgHithlighter.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
addHighlighter(new AuditTableCellsHighlighter(DefaultJXTable.this, ColorUtil.showColorChooser(DefaultJXTable.this), CELLS_FG));
}
});
tablePopupMenu.add(cellsfgHithlighter);
JMenuItem rowsbgHithlighter = new JMenuItem("设置行背景色");
rowsbgHithlighter.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
addHighlighter(new AuditTableRowsHighlighter(DefaultJXTable.this, ColorUtil.showColorChooser(DefaultJXTable.this), ROWS_BG));
}
});
tablePopupMenu.add(rowsbgHithlighter);
JMenuItem rowsfgHithlighter = new JMenuItem("设置行前景色");
rowsfgHithlighter.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
addHighlighter(new AuditTableRowsHighlighter(DefaultJXTable.this, ColorUtil.showColorChooser(DefaultJXTable.this), ROWS_FG));
}
});
tablePopupMenu.add(rowsfgHithlighter);
JMenuItem columnsbgHithlighter = new JMenuItem("设置列背景色");
columnsbgHithlighter.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
addHighlighter(new AuditTableColumnsHighlighter(DefaultJXTable.this, ColorUtil.showColorChooser(DefaultJXTable.this), COLUMNS_BG));
}
});
tablePopupMenu.add(columnsbgHithlighter);
JMenuItem columnsfgHithlighter = new JMenuItem("设置列前景色");
columnsfgHithlighter.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
addHighlighter(new AuditTableColumnsHighlighter(DefaultJXTable.this, ColorUtil.showColorChooser(DefaultJXTable.this), COLUMNS_FG));
}
});
tablePopupMenu.add(columnsfgHithlighter);
JMenuItem repaint = new JMenuItem("repaint");
repaint.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
DefaultJXTable.this.repaint();
}
});
tablePopupMenu.add(repaint);
addMouseListener(new MouseAdapter() {
@Override
public void mouseReleased(MouseEvent e) {
if (e.getButton() == MouseEvent.BUTTON3) {
tablePopupMenu.show(DefaultJXTable.this, e.getX(), e.getY());
}
}
});
}
}
